willland Posted January 16, 2021 Share Posted January 16, 2021 How large is your room? If under 2000ft3, I would suggest a pair of smaller subs like the SVS SB1000s. Though my RSW-10d(before the amp took a dump) was plenty with my RB-75s in a 3000ft3+ room. Bill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
